Transaction e80edddc7643ead55260ca883e05f191487fc43b0a5c8a62cd9b56abcd90eb08

1 Input
2 Outputs
  • e80edddc7643ead55260ca883e05f191487fc43b0a5c8a62cd9b56abcd90eb08:0
  • value  103915
    address  3KDdx66DUhayEdpBu1CBzNQryeyhrtKQnt
  • e80edddc7643ead55260ca883e05f191487fc43b0a5c8a62cd9b56abcd90eb08:1
  • value  355487
    address  113vgHuvXyKkk7QwcK9tprvHcnr7z33pb2